Ben West's THE AMERICAN MUSICAL: EVOLUTION OF AN ART FORM Sets April Release

Routledge, an imprint of the Taylor & Francis Group, will release the new book from musical theater artist and historian Ben West, The American Musical: Evolution of an Art Form, on April 1, 2024.

Museum of Broadway to Present 'Early Black Authors of the American Musical' Conversation with Ben West

On February 22nd, the Museum of Broadway will be presenting a free lecture from Resident Historian and Timeline Walls Curator Ben West, titled “Early Black Authors of the American Musical.”
Museum of Broadway Announces Student and Senior Pricing

The Museum of Broadway has announced new special pricing for student and senior visitors. The Museum, located in the heart of Times Square at 145 W 45th St, is the first-ever permanent museum dedicated to the storied history and legendary artistry of Broadway musicals, plays, and theatres.
